css伪类原理指的是什么

  介绍

小编给大家分享一下css伪类原理是什么,希望大家阅读完这篇文章后大所收获、下面让我们一起去探讨吧!

css伪类原理是指伪类对元素进行分类,是基于特征的特点,而不是它们的名字,属性或者内容,原则上特征是不可以从文档树上推断得到的,在感觉上伪类可以是动态的,当用户和文档进行交互的时候一个元素可以获取或者失去一个伪类。

<强> css伪类原理是什么?

解释:伪类对元素进行分类是基于特征(特征)而不是它们的名字,属性或者内容;

原则上特征是不可以从文档树上推断得到的。在感觉上伪类可以是动态的,当用户和文档进行交互的时候一个元素可以获取或者失去一个伪类。

例外的是“:first-child"能通过文档树推断出来,“:lang"在一些情况下也在从文档树中推断出来。

伪类有:::链接:,第一个孩子:徘徊:vistited,活跃:专注:朗

<强>何为伪类?

就是css内部本身赋予它一些特性和功能,也就是你不用再类=騣d=憔涂梢灾苯幽美词褂?当然你也可以改变它的部分属性比如:答:链接{颜色:# ff0000;}

css很多的建议并没有得到浏览器的支持,但有四个可以安全使用的用在连接上的伪类。分别是链接,vistited,悬停和活跃。

答:链接{颜色:# 000000;}/*设置一个对象在未被访问前的样式。*/答:悬停{颜色:# 000000;}/*设置对象在其鼠标悬停时的样式。*/答:活跃{颜色:# 000000;}/*设置对象在被用户激活(在鼠标点击与释放之间发生的事件)时的样式。*/答:访问{颜色:# 000000;}/*设置一个对象在其链接地址已被访问过时的样式。*/

css伪类原理指的是什么